Celebrated throughout the world as Chinese New Year, Lunar New Year, or Spring Festival (春节; pinyin: Chūnjié), Lunar New Year typically falls on the second new moon after the winter solstice. Lunar New Year falls on different dates each year, but always falls between February 10 and February 24 of the international standard calendar. Its traditional Chinese celebrations last for 16 days, from Lunar New Year's Eve to the Lantern Festival. Chinese New Year, also known as Lunar New Year or Spring Festival, is the most important traditional holiday in China. With a history spanning over 3,000 years, the day celebrates the turn of the Lunar calendar. Each person's zodiac sign is decided by their birth year.Traditionally, Chinese people believe that each zodiac sign has fated personality traits and each different zodiac year has a lot to do with personal horoscopes.
